The Bahrom International Program covers Korean Contempory Issues, Art, Language, Traditions, Film, Economics and Politics, and Religion. The program also includes group excursions and special events. NMSU students attend the program on exchange and pay a special course fee that covers tuition, room and board. NMSU students may earn 6 credits for this program. June 29-July 25, 2008.
